Eat a wholesome meal

Before visit at White Rat Tattoo, naszym studio in Warsaw, eat a filling and well-balanced meal. Stress before a first or subsequent tattoo session often causes a loss of appetite; however, getting tattooed is physically demanding and requires an adequate amount of energy.

A nutritious meal helps maintain stable blood sugar levels, reduces the risk of feeling faint, and enables your body to better cope with the discomfort of getting a tattoo. This makes the session much more comfortable for both you and the tattoo artist.

Avoid sun

If You are planing tattoo in Warsaw, ensure your skin is in good condition. Avoid tanning and prolonged sun exposure for a few days before your appointment.

Tattoos are not performed on skin that is tanned, sunburned, irritated, abraded, wounded, cut, or has undergone chemical peels.

Healthy, unirritated skin allows the tattoo artist to execute the tattoo precisely and significantly influences the proper healing process.

Ensure proper hydration

Drink the right amount of water regularly in the days leading up to the session. A well-hydrated body means better-prepared skin.

Proper hydration increases skin elasticity, facilitates tattooing, and promotes faster recovery after the session. It's one of the easiest ways to prepare for your appointment at tattoo studio..

Moisturize your skin

For about a week before your appointment, regularly apply a moisturizing lotion or cream, ideally once or twice a day.

Well-hydrated skin is more elastic, making it easier for the skin to take the ink and better able to withstand the tattooing process. This has a positive impact on both comfort during the session and the subsequent healing of the tattoo.

But remember to do not apply lotion or cream immediately before the appointment in tattoo studio.

Don't rush

Plan your day so that you don't have to rush. Allow enough time and do not schedule important meetings or other commitments immediately after the session.

Getting a tattoo requires focus, precision, and a calm atmosphere. Rushing can negatively impact the client's comfort and the tattoo artist's work. In White Rat Tattoo Warsaw we always prioritize the highest quality, which is why it is worth allowing yourself plenty of time.

Come sober

Arrive at your tattoo session completely sober and well-rested.

Do not consume alcohol or intoxicants before your appointment. Also, do not use numbing creams without first consulting your tattoo artist. If you plan to use a numbing products, please discuss it with us beforehand—if necessary, we use only proven products available at our studio in Warsaw.

Alcohol, drugs, and the improper use of anesthetics can increase the risk of complications, complicate the tattooing process, and negatively affect the quality and durability of the finished tattoo.
